Maintaining Your 2019 Honda Civic's Wheel Studs and Nuts
For any car enthusiast or even a casual driver, understanding the nuts and bolts of your vehicle can significantly improve your maintenance skills and ensure a safer driving experience. If you own a 2019 Honda Civic, you should know that wheel studs and nuts are indeed essential components of your vehicle. They play a crucial role in securing your wheels to the car, and proper maintenance can prevent a host of potential problems down the line. Here's a comprehensive guide to help you manage wheel studs and nuts replacement or maintenance.
Regular maintenance checks should include the inspection of the wheel studs and nuts for wear and damage. Why is this so important? Because damaged wheel studs or improperly fastened wheel nuts can lead to serious and potentially dangerous situations such as the loss of a wheel while driving. Let's break down the steps and best practices to ensure your wheel studs and nuts are in top condition.
- Visual Inspection: Regularly inspect the wheel studs for any signs of rust, wear, or damage. Similarly, check the wheel nuts for any signs of stripping or damage. It's crucial to catch these issues early to avoid them worsening.
- Torque Settings: Always ensure wheel nuts are tightened to the manufacturer's recommended torque settings. If you have recently changed a tyre or rotated the wheels, re-torque the wheel nuts after about 100 kilometres. This helps to ensure that they have not loosened after initial fitting.
- Thread Condition: When inspecting your wheel studs, pay close attention to the threading. If you find any that are stripped or showing signs of wear, they should be replaced immediately. A damaged thread can prevent proper fastening of your wheel nut.
- Rust and Corrosion: If you notice any rust or corrosion, it's crucial to address it promptly. Rust can weaken the material, leading to potential failure. Use a wire brush to remove light rust and apply an anti-seize solution to protect the studs and nuts.
- Replacement Procedures: When it becomes necessary to replace a wheel stud or nut, it's important to do so correctly. Begin by safely jacking up your vehicle and removing the wheel. You can then remove the brake caliper and rotor, if necessary, to access the wheel stud. Press out the old stud and replace it with a new one, ensuring it is seated correctly. When reinstalling the wheel, torque the wheel nuts to the correct specifications.
- Professional Assistance: If you're unsure about performing any of these steps, or if more complex issues arise, seeking professional help is always a good idea. A certified mechanic can ensure that the replacement or maintenance of wheel studs and nuts is done correctly.
- Regular Checks: Incorporate wheel stud and nut inspections into your regular vehicle maintenance schedule. Doing this routinely, such as during oil changes or tyre rotations, can prevent significant issues from developing.
